Clint Hill

The one positive to come out last night’s team selection was former captain Clint Hill. The 37-year-old bleeds blue and white and only the injured Jamie Mackie rivals his dedication to the club. His style of play, while not always pretty, is effective and his effort is admirable.

Hill made a couple of goal denying tackles during the 90 minutes and was perhaps lucky not to be sent-off for a last man challenge on Modou Sougou just before halftime. Sougou had almost left Hill for dead, but the Merseyside man threw a leg out and brought the forward down. No doubt a dubious challenge, but the experience and determination to make such tackles proved invaluable in holding on to a point.

Hill’s introduction also pushed Nedum Onouha out to right-back to replace James Perch. It was obvious the Onouha benefitted from Hill’s presence, as Rangers recorded their second clean sheet of the season.
